#779f98 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#779f98 is composed of 46.7% red, 62.4%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 25.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 4.4% yellow and 37.6% black. It has a hue angle of 169.5 degrees, a saturation of 17.2% and a lightness of 54.5%. #779f98 color hex could be obtained by blending #eeffff with #003f31. Closest websafe color is: #669999.

Shades and Tints of #779f98

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010202 is the darkest color, while #f5f8f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#779f98

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#898d8c is the less saturated color, while #1ef8d2 is the most saturated one.
